#8480da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8480da is composed of 51.8% red, 50.2%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.4% cyan, 41.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 242.7 degrees, a saturation of 54.9% and a lightness of 67.8%. #8480da color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0901b5.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#8480da color description : Very soft blue.

#8480da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8480da has RGB values of R:132, G:128,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 8683738.

Shades and Tints of #8480da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03030a is the darkest color, while #fafaf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8480da

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acacae is the less saturated color, while #6760fa is the most saturated one.
